Description
2,6-Dimethoxybenzenethiol CAS NO 26163-11-1 is a specialized aromatic thiol compound characterized by its unique methoxy-substituted benzene ring. This chemical is a critical building block in advanced organic synthesis, valued for its role as a nucleophile and a precursor to complex heterocyclic structures. It is primarily sought by research institutions and manufacturers in the pharmaceutical and agrochemical sectors for developing novel active ingredients and functional materials.
Application
- Pharmaceutical Intermediate: Key precursor in the synthesis of complex drug molecules, particularly those with sulfur-containing heterocycles.
- Agrochemical Synthesis: Used in the development of new pesticides, herbicides, and fungicides where the thiol group imparts specific biological activity.
- Ligand and Catalyst Preparation: Serves as a starting material for creating specialized ligands used in metal-catalyzed cross-coupling reactions.
- Material Science Research: Employed in the development of novel polymers, resins, and organic electronic materials.
- Chemical Research & Development: A versatile reagent for exploring new synthetic pathways and creating custom chemical libraries in R&D laboratories.
Basic Information
| Product Name | 2,6-Dimethoxybenzenethiol |
| CAS No. | 26163-11-1 |
| Molecular Formula | C8H10O2S |
| Molecular Weight | 170.23 g/mol |
| Synonyms | 2,6-Dimethoxybenzenethiol; 2,6-Dimethoxythiophenol; 1,3-Dimethoxy-2-mercaptobenzene; Benzenethiol, 2,6-dimethoxy-; 2,6-Dimethoxybenzene-1-thiol; 2,6-Dimethoxyphenyl mercaptan; 2-Mercapto-1,3-dimethoxybenzene |

Storage
Preserve in a tightly closed container, protected from light. Store under an inert atmosphere (e.g., nitrogen or argon) at controlled room temperature (15-25°C) in a cool, dry, and well-ventilated area. This product is easily oxidized; prolonged exposure to air should be avoided to maintain purity and stability.
